What is an engineering review?

Engineering reviews are systematic assessments of engineering designs, documents, or processes conducted by a team to ensure accuracy, quality, and compliance with standards. These reviews can take the form of design reviews, technical reviews, or peer reviews and help identify potential issues early in a project, reducing risks and improving outcomes. They are an essential part of engineering project management and quality assurance, often involving cross-disciplinary collaboration. The goal is to verify that the engineering solution meets all requirements and to recommend improvements before implementation.

What are the key skills and qualifications needed to thrive in engineering reviews, and why are they important?

To excel in Engineering Reviews, you need a strong background in engineering principles, attention to detail, and experience with industry standards, typically supported by an engineering degree or certification. Familiarity with technical documentation, CAD software, and project management tools like AutoCAD, SolidWorks, or MS Project is often required. Critical thinking, clear communication, and collaboration are crucial soft skills for evaluating designs and providing constructive feedback. These competencies ensure that engineering projects meet safety, quality, and regulatory standards, contributing to efficient and successful project outcomes.

What are some common challenges faced by professionals in engineering reviews, and how can they be addressed?

Professionals in Engineering Reviews often encounter challenges such as balancing thoroughness with tight project deadlines, communicating technical feedback effectively to multi-disciplinary teams, and staying updated with evolving standards and regulations. To address these, it helps to develop strong organizational skills, establish clear communication channels with stakeholders, and participate in ongoing professional development. Collaboration with other engineering and design teams is also essential to ensure that feedback is constructive and leads to continuous improvement in project outcomes.

Job description

Overview

GENERAL DESCRIPTION

The Engineering Coordination Manager is responsible for connecting people, projects, and engineering organizations to ensure effective execution of engineering activities across the business. This role serves as a key liaison between regional engineering teams, global stakeholders, customers, and cross-functional departments to promote consistent communication, resource alignment, project visibility, and technical collaboration.The Engineering Coordination Manager facilitates coordination among engineering disciplines and business functions to support timely project execution, standardization of engineering practices, issue resolution, and continuous improvement initiatives. This position plays a critical role in bridging organizational, cultural, and geographic boundaries, particularly between North American operations and global engineering partners, to ensure alignment of priorities, objectives, and engineering deliverables.
